Title :
A digital-analog mixed-voltage crossing point precision detection method

Abstract :
The digital - analog hybrid device is used to achieve the high-precision detection of the grid voltage based on the algorithm of biquadrate Butterworth band pass filter which is achieved by the digital algorithm based on MSP430F169 MCU. Then the fact influencing the filter performance is analyzed by the different quality factor Q. And a voltage zero-crossing modified algorithm is realized by the grid frequency fluctuation based on the phase compensation method. The effect of frequency fluctuation on the output phase is eliminated by the phase feed-forward compensation. The sampling error of the digital algorithm is compensated by the circuit of RC analog filter.
